2011-09-28 3 views
1

У меня есть список элементов:как я могу связать элемент списка с выбором выпадающего меню

<li>A</li> 
<li>B</li> 

и выпадающий список:

<select>  
    <options value="A">A</options> 
    <options value="B">B</options>  
</select> 

Как я могу связать оба вместе?

Я хочу изменить значение выбора текста <li>, который пользователь нажимает. Таким образом, если пользователь нажмет <li>A</li>, значение <select> будет установлено А.

+0

Пожалуйста, будьте более конкретным с вашим вопросом. Я понятия не имею, что вы хотите. Предоставьте код или ссылку на пример или что-то еще. –

ответ

2

Попробуйте что-то вроде этого:

$('ul li').click(function() { 
    var elem=$(this).text(); 
    $("select option[value='"+elem+"']").attr('selected', 'selected'); 
}); 
1
$("#list li").click(function(){ 

var index = $(this).text(); 

$("#dropdown").val(index); 

}); 

Вот один из способов, хотя вы можете изменить переменную index в соответствии с вашими потребностями ,

Смежные вопросы